> On 03/05/2012 08:58 PM, José Alonso wrote:
> > Hi all,
> >
> > I have 2 Debian nodes with heartbeat and pacemaker 1.1.6 installed, and
> > almost everything is working fine, I have only apache configured for
> > testing, when a node goes down the failover is done correctly, but
> > there's a problem when a node failbacks.
> >
> > For example, let's say that Node1 has the lead on apache resource, then
> > I reboot Node1, so Pacemaker detect it goes down, then apache is
> > promoted to the Node2 and it keeps there running fine, that's fine, but
> > when Node1 recovers and joins the cluster again, apache is restarted on
> > Node2 again.
> >
> > Anyone knows, why resources are restarted when a node rejoins a cluster ?
> >
> > This is my pacemaker configuration:
> >
> > node $id="2ac5f37d-cd54-4932-92dc-418b4fd0e6e6" nodo2 \
> > attributes standby="off"
> > node $id="938594ef-839a-40bb-aa5e-5715622693b3" nodo1 \
> > attributes standby="off"
> > primitive apache2 lsb:apache2 \
> > meta migration-threshold="1" failure-timeout="2" \
> > op monitor interval="5s" resource-stickiness="INFINITY"
> > primitive ip1 ocf:heartbeat:IPaddr2 \
> > params ip="192.168.1.38" nic="eth0:0"
> > primitive ip1arp ocf:heartbeat:SendArp \
> > params ip="192.168.1.38" nic="eth0:0"
> > group WebServices ip1 ip1arp apache2
> > location cli-prefer-WebServices WebServices \
> > rule $id="cli-prefer-rule-WebServices" inf: #uname eq nodo2
>
> remove that migration constraint ("cli-prefer-....") and try again ...
> best practice is to remove such a constraint immediately after the
> resource migration is completed.
